Suwarna Gedde mathu Kadle kai Huli. (Elephant yam & Chickpea curry) 

It’s a Mangalorean recipe and usually relished at every home as it’s very delicious and can be prepared with limited ingredients. In the coastal areas, Elephant yam ( Suran in Hindi) is also known as Kene.
